I have a 29er with 29 x 2.25 tires and a 27.5+ bike with 27.5 x 3.0 tires (almost equal diameter to 29er).

My 29er I have to pick my lines riding single track. If I don't then the tires, more often than not, slide off the trail features which may or may not result in a dismount/crash. With my 27.5+ I just roll over obstacles and don't think about picking a line.

27.5+ is about better traction and roll over.
